Hier is Grand Theft Auto 5 op een originele Game Boy, op een of andere manier

0
509

Lateraal denken met verdorde technologie.

Sebastian Staacks is een coder en ouderwetse knutselaar. Zijn blog There Oughta Be staat vol met technische rariteiten, van LED-kubussen tot een geautomatiseerd irrigatiesysteem voor zijn gazon. Nu heeft Staacks de nostalgische lat een stuk hoger gelegd door eerst een WiFi-Game Boy-cartridge te maken en er nu in te slagen Grand Theft Auto 5 en Doom te laten draaien op Nintendo’s klassieke hardware.

“Een paar weken geleden heb ik een Game Boy-cassette gemaakt met ingebouwde WiFi,” schrijft Staacks. “Nu heb ik het geleerd om video te streamen en games te spelen-in volledige resolutie. Met 20 fps. Op een ongemodificeerde originele Game Boy.”

Staacks heeft een technische writeup van hoe hij het deed (hier), en een eenvoudigere video explainer, waarin je het spel kunt zien draaien op de hardware. Het ziet er duidelijk uit als precies wat het is: Een zingende en dansende technische showcase op hardware uit 1989 die zelfs bij de lancering al onterecht als verouderd werd afgedaan. Met andere woorden, absolute magie.

De video hieronder begint wanneer Staacks speldemo’s op het apparaat laat zien.

Het originele Game Boy-scherm is duidelijk niet ideaal voor deze taak, vooral als het op contrast aankomt. Een andere reden om jaloers te zijn op Staacks is dat hij een Pocket in handen heeft, die een ongelooflijk scherm heeft, en hieronder laat zien hoe de trucjes van het WiFi-karretje eruit zien op dat scherm.

Grand Theft Auto 5 is duidelijk het hoogtepunt hier, want, nou, wow. Staacks’ WiFi-karretje kwam met instructies voor anderen om hun eigen te bouwen, en een van zijn volgelingen greep natuurlijk naar de eeuwige favoriet dat is Doom.

“Met deze nieuwe demo,” schrijft Staacks, “worden vele andere demo’s bijna overbodig. Ik kan alles weergeven en ik kan alles besturen dat kan worden weergegeven op en bestuurd door mijn PC. Natuurlijk zijn de interface en het beeld op deze manier bijna onbruikbaar, dus sommige speciale implementaties zouden nog interessant kunnen zijn. En ook, ik heb hier geen audio aangeraakt, wat helaas een grote vergissing van mij was bij het ontwerpen van deze cartridge.”

Schema’s, broncode en gedetailleerde uitleg (kan hier worden gevonden).